
What produces magnetism in the human body?
Answer
502.5k+ views
Hint:Magnetic fields mediate a family of physical properties known as magnetism. A magnetic field is created by electric currents and the magnetic moments of elementary particles, which operates on other currents and magnetic moments. Electromagnetism is a multifaceted phenomenon that includes magnetism.
Complete answer:
Magnetism was created by weak ionic currents in the human body. For the first time, scientists have mapped magnetic materials in human brains, suggesting that our brains may contain more magnetic material in lower and older areas. Researchers analysed brain tissue for evidence of magnetite, Earth's most magnetic mineral, using seven specimens donated in Germany. Other forms of life, such as some types of bacteria, have been discovered to possess magnetite, according to scientists. However, because no comprehensive investigation had previously mapped the mineral in human tissue, the location of magnetite in human brains was unknown. According to the current research, the magnetic remanence of the lower areas of the human brain, including the cerebellum and brain stem, was 2 or more times that of the higher areas. The cerebrum is made up of the higher portions of the brain and is in charge of reasoning, speaking, and other activities, while the lower portions are in charge of muscular movement and automatic activities like heart rate and respiration.
